精华内容
下载资源
问答
  • 计算机处理器的未来——多核处理器自从计算机诞生以来,推动处理器高速发展的源动力主要有两方面:微电子技术飞速进步和处理器体系结构演化发展。于1965年提出的摩(本文共1页)阅读全文>>多核技术成为当今处理器...

    计算机处理器的未来——多核处理器

    自从计算机诞生以来,推动处理器高速发展的源动力主要有两方面:微电子技术飞速进步和处理器体系结构演化发展。于1965年提出的摩

    (本文共1页)

    阅读全文>>

    多核技术成为当今处理器技术发展的重要方向,已经是计算机系统设计者必须直面的现实。从计算机系统结构...

    (本文共10页)

    阅读全文>>

    多核处理器已经成为市场主流。毫无疑问,多核结构可以带来双倍的运算能力,但并非...

    (本文共3页)

    阅读全文>>

    随着多核处理器系统复杂度的增加以及视频标准多样性的增加,视频多核处理器的设计难度和成本也大幅度增加。为了得到一个通用而又高效的多核处理器设计平台,以减小多核系统设计的复杂度,提出一种新型视频多...

    (本文共4页)

    阅读全文>>

    随着嵌入式技术的不断发展,HMPU逐渐广泛应用于高性能计算领域。异构多核处理器,即具有两个或以上处理器内核的处理器,因其计算效率高,且可针对不同应用调整结构,其应用相当广泛。在具体应用中,多核处理器的不同处理器核之间需要进行大量的、频繁的数据交换,因此,处理器核间的通信效率严重影响处理器的性能。目前通过调查研究,异构多核处理器芯片核间通信领域已经在国内外取得了一些显著研究成果。该文结合以上研究成果,针对电子系统数...

    (本文共5页)

    阅读全文>>

    在单个处理器下,集成的两个及以上晚上计算引擎/内核即为多核处理器,能够使处理器运行系统总线下不同处理器,命令信号、总线控制...

    (本文共1页)

    阅读全文>>

    展开全文
  • 为了解决基于并行总线结构的抗恶劣环境计算机通用性差的问题,提出了一种基于国产多核处理器的可重构计算机的设计方法,该方法包括了基于国产多核处理器的可重构计算机的主要设计思路和实现过程;在该方法中通过采用...
  • 为了解决基于并行总线结构的抗恶劣环境计算机通用性差的问题,提出了一种基于国产多核处理器的可重构计算机的设计方法,该方法包括了基于国产多核处理器的可重构计算机的主要设计思路和实现过程;在该方法中通过采用...
  • 以基于多核处理器的弹载计算机为例,介绍了功率消耗产生的原理,从处理器、软件设计、Cache设计和可编程逻辑设计等方面对影响弹载计算机系统功耗的因素进行了分析,并提出了低功耗设计的方法和技巧。
  • 摘要:为了解决基于并行总线结构的抗恶劣环境计算机通用性差的问题,提出了一种基于国产多核处理器的可重构计算机的设计方法,该方法包括了基于国产多核处理器的可重构计算机的主要设计思路和实现过程;在该方法中...
  • 从技术上来说,单处理器的已经不能满足日益增长的对性能的要求了。...在这个过程中,多核处理器的应用范围已覆盖了多媒体计算、嵌入式设备、个人计算机、商用服务器和高性能计算机等众多领域,多核技术及其相关
  • 多核处理器介绍

    千次阅读 2020-03-24 11:18:22
    多核处理器是单枚芯片(也称为硅核),能够直接插入单一的处理器插槽中,但操作系统会利用所有相关的资源,将它的每个执行内核作为分立的逻辑处理器。通过在多个执行内核之间划分任务,多核处理器可在特定的时钟周期...

    多核是多微处理器核的简称,是将两个或更多的独立处理器封装在一起,集成在一个电路中。多核处理器是单枚芯片(也称为硅核),能够直接插入单一的处理器插槽中,但操作系统会利用所有相关的资源,将它的每个执行内核作为分立的逻辑处理器。通过在多个执行内核之间划分任务,多核处理器可在特定的时钟周期内执行更多任务。

    多线程是指从软件或者硬件上实现多个线程并发执行的技术。具有多线程能力的计算机因有硬件支持而能够在同一时间执行多于一个线程,进而提升整体处理性能。具有这种能力的系统包括对称多处理机、多核心处理器以及芯片级多处理或同时多线程处理器。在一个程序中,这些独立运行的程序片段叫作“线程”,利用它编程的概念就叫作“多线程处理”。

    如果某个系统支持两个或者多个动作(Action)同时存在,那么这个系统就是一个并发系统。如果某个系统支持两个或者多个动作同时执行,那么这个系统就是一个并行系统。

     

    多核编程技术主要包括并行计算、共享资源分布式计算、任务分解与调度、Lock-Free编程等内容。其中共享资源分布式计算、任务分解与调度是最重要的内容,也是大多数程序员未接触过的内容,许多并行算法都可以通过它们来实现。多核编程模式主要是提供一种多核并行与分布式编程的普遍方法,有了这些编程模式后,程序员不再需要去学习各种复杂的并行算法,它可以复用现有的串行算法,很容易地实现并行和分布式计算。在多核编程技术中,最重要的一点是如何将计算均匀分摊到各个CPU核上。

    多核时代的到来,给程序员的编程思维带来了巨大的冲击和挑战。为了能够充分利用多核性能,程序员必须学会以分块的思维设计程序,以多进程或多线程的形式来编写程序。到底应该使用多进程还是多线程的形式来编写程序,是最让程序员感到困惑的问题之一,这些需要根据具体的应用来决定。在通常情况下,使用多线程进行多核编程比使用多进程有更大的优势,因为:

    (1)线程的创建和切换开销比进程更小。

    (2)线程之间通信的方式比较多,而且简单也更有效率。

    (3)多线程有很多的基础库支持。

    (4)多线程的程序比多进程的程序更容易理解和修改。

    除了编程形式,使用多线程编程的动机也发生了改变。过去,Windows程序员使用多线程的主要原因之一是为了提高用户程序运行效率,例如,在长时间的计算中提高GUI、I/O或者网络的响应速度。而在多核时代编写应用程序为了充分利用多个计算核心,缩短计算时间,或者在相同的时间段内计算更多任务。例如,在进行游戏编程时,通过多线程的方式把碰撞检测的计算分散到多个CPU内核,就可以大大缩减计算时间,也可以利用多核做更细致的检测计算,从而能够模拟更加真实的碰撞。

    处理器所能交换的最小存储单元就是一个cache行,或者一个cache块。两个独立的cache在需要读取同一cache行时,会共享该cache行。但如果在其中一个cache中,该cache行被写入,而在另一个cache中该cache行被读取,那么即使读写的地址不相交,也需要在这两个cache之间移动该cache行。就像两个人同时在写一本日志的两个不同部分,两人的写入动作相互独立,但是除非将日志撕成两半,否则这两个人必须来回地互相传递这本日志。同样地,两个硬件线程在写入一个cache的不同部分时,互相竞争cache,就像在进行乒乓球比赛。

    展开全文
  • win10系统使用久了,好多网友反馈说关于对win10系统开启多核处理器设置的方法,在使用win10系统的过程中经常不知道如何去对win10系统开启多核处理器进行设置,有什么好的办法去设置win10系统开启多核处理器呢?...

    win10系统使用久了,好多网友反馈说关于对win10系统开启多核处理器设置的方法,在使用win10系统的过程中经常不知道如何去对win10系统开启多核处理器进行设置,有什么好的办法去设置win10系统开启多核处理器呢?在这里小编教你只需要1、首先使用快捷键“win+R”打开“运行”窗口,接着在窗口中输入“msconfig”并点回车就可以打开系统配置窗口了。 2、接下来切换到“引导”的窗口,再选择“高级选项”。就搞定了。下面小编就给小伙伴们分享一下对win10系统开启多核处理器进行设置的问题,针对此问题小编给大家收集整理的问题,针对此问题小编给大家收集整理具体的图文步骤:

    1、首先使用快捷键“win+R”打开“运行”窗口,接着在窗口中输入“msconfig”并点回车就可以打开系统配置窗口了。

    c858084886c08021c91531b4fa461dcf.png

    2、接下来切换到“引导”的窗口,再选择“高级选项”。

    4335831cf3eeb3b64a19e5c7cfc9afd3.png

    3、接下来会弹出如下图中所示的设置窗口,这里的处理器数也就是咱们所说的单核双核了,点击下方的横条,然后将默认的1修改为2,也就是代表双核了。至于最大内存,可以调整到2048,会比较合适,设置完成之后,点击下方的确定退出窗口即可。

    e48510301879ead9ef4182620c7fb9b5.png

    展开全文
  • 基于国产多核处理器的可重构计算机设计(一)    2.1.1 器件选型  计算机器件的选型不仅关系到计算机的整体性能,更重要的是,直接影响到潜在用户目标系统在开发时硬件设计的复杂度。因此在完成预期功能要求的...
  • 多个处理器和多核处理器的区别

    万次阅读 多人点赞 2017-04-16 16:46:50
    多核处理器:单个多核处理器,也就是说电脑有一个处理器,但是这个处理器是多核的;  当然他们之间有这个很大的区别,对于这两个疑点,或许你一直是这么认为的(对于时间的执行效率有区别),但是更重要的

    最近遇到了一个让人很是疑惑的问题,然后写出来供大家解疑:



    多个处理器&多核处理器?

    多个处理器:多个单核处理器,就是说电脑和处理器有多个,但是这个电脑的处理器是单核的;

    多核处理器:单个多核处理器,也就是说电脑有一个处理器,但是这个处理器是多核的;

            当然他们之间有这个很大的区别,对于这两个疑点,或许你一直是这么认为的(对于时间的执行效率有区别),但是更重要的不止这些,最为重要的是它们的资源利用率问题,下面我们讨论一下关于二者究竟谁更优秀:

            对于多个处理器而言,它们在执行命令的时候多个处理器之间的通信手段是电脑主板上的总线;而对于多核处理器而言,多个核心处理器之间通信时通过CPU内部总线进行信息的交互的。对于执行效率而言,多核处理器要优于多个处理器,在生活中,我们的电脑上常见的处理器都是单处理器,但是这个处理器是多核的,当然,一些IT工作者的电脑如果是在要求较高的环境下工作时,都采用的多个多核处理器配置。

           当然对于进程和线程问题而言,结合处理器问题,是这样的,进程资源调度的基本单位,线程是进程的一个实体,是一个执行单元,一个进程可能包含有很多个线程,计算机在启动之后,一个进程最少包含一个主线程,如果这个主线程结束了,那么这个进程也就终止执行了,主线程是以函数的形式提供给操作系统的。对于并行计算是在多处理器的情况下,操作系统把多个线程分配给响应的处理器,然后各自执行任务。

    展开全文
  • 从技术上来说,单核心处理器的已经不能满足日益增长的对性能的要求了。...在这个过程中,多核处理器的应用范围已覆盖了多媒体计算、嵌入式设备、个人计算机、商用服务器和高性能计算机等众多领域,
  •  摘要:目前关于处理器的单核、双核和多核已经得到了普遍的运用,今天我们主要说说关于多核处理器的一些相关概念,它的工作与那里以及优缺点而展开的分析。  1、多核处理器  多核处理器是指在一枚处理器中集成...
  • 什么XP中多核处理器会只显示单核呢?是什么原因呢?下面是学习啦小编收集整理的XP中多核处理器只显示单核,希望对大家有帮助~~XP中多核处理器只显示单核1.右键我的电脑——属性 ——硬件——设备管理器——点击CPU...
  • 多核处理器发展

    2019-12-19 14:54:25
    多核处理器最直接的发展则认为是始于 IBM。IBM 在 2001 年发布了双核 RISC 处理器 POWER4,它将两个 64 位 PowerPC 处理器内核集成在同一颗芯片上,成为首款采用多核设计的服务器处理器。在 UNIX 阵营当中,两大巨头...
  • 多核处理器

    千次阅读 2013-09-20 23:40:33
    接着突然发现以前自己知道的好多东西都忘记了,竟然连CPU的多核是怎 么回事都忘记了。 今天专门在网上找了各方面资料熟悉了一下,下面说一下。 首先我们要知道CPU是什么东西。CPU,中央处理器。是计算机组成中必不可...
  • 自从计算机诞生以来,推动处理器高速发展的源动采用共享Cache或者内存的方式,多线程的通信延迟会明显力主要有两方面:微电子技术飞速进步和处理器体系结构降低;4、低功耗:通过动态调 节电压/频率、负载优化分...
  • 【转】多核处理器的工作原理及优缺点 《处理器关于多核概念与区别 多核处理器工作原理及优缺点》原文传送门  摘要:目前关于处理器的单核、双核和多核已经得到了普遍的运用,今天我们主要说说关于多核处理器的...
  • 多核处理器环境中,每个线程在独立的核上运行,线程间具有并发性。利用并发的线程模拟可重构阵列单元(PE)的运算方式,调用OpenMP设置多个线程并行执行,在多核计算机平台上模拟可重构处理器的计算过程。利用此方法...
  • 您尝试了一个多核处理器计算机上安装 Microsoft SQL Server 2005 和满足下列条件之一为真: 该比率逻辑处理器和物理套接字之间不是 2 的幂。例如对于计算机有单个插座一起使用三层核心的处理器。 物理内核的...
  • 条件:您尝试了一个多核处理器计算机上安装 Microsoft SQL Server 2005 和满足下列条件之一为真: 1、该比率逻辑处理器和物理套接字之间不是 2 的幂。例如对于计算机有单个插座一起使用三层核心的处理器。 2、...
  • 随着航天技术的不断发展和研究...文章主要阐述了针对星务计算机上基于S698PM的CPCI接口的Space Wire数据总线终端系统的硬件设计,为今后S698PM多核处理器和Space Wire总线在我国其他航天任务中的应用打下了良好的基础。
  • 摘要:航空电子架构综合模块化航空电子(Integrated Modular Avionic,IMA)已成为主流航空电子系统,ARINC653作为...如何在多核处理器环境中对任务进行高效的调度成为ARINC653多核任务调度的关键问题,本文提出一种基于...
  • T1042 CPU 最高四核1.4GHz 板载FPGA(XC6SLX100T-3FGG900I) 板载DSP(TMS320F28377SZWTS) 板载ETHERCAT从站控制器(ET1100-0003) 2GB DDR3 1600MT/s内存带ECC 板载TF卡 支持Linux、VxWorks ...
  • 该高性能计算机采用飞思卡尔公司最新的QorIQ T系列旗舰级处理器T4240。T4240丰富的接口和强大的运算能力在本产品上得到了完美的体现,为当今嵌入式计算应用提供了无与伦比的多核性能,适用于雷达、声纳、电子对抗、...
  • Windows 10多核处理器改为单核的方法

    万次阅读 2018-03-12 17:42:09
    为了测试多线程的调度情况,有时候需要将计算机多核处理器改为单核。 2.步骤如下: 通过快捷键Win + R打开运行窗口,录入MSCONFIG,如下图所示: 按下回车键,会弹出系统配置窗口,如下: 选择引导页签,...
  • 操作系统与多核处理器

    万次阅读 2017-11-10 18:00:12
    这篇文章解答了我心中的疑问,那就是操作系统会自动调度cpu资源来处理多进程,多线程的并发。    早在上世纪90年代末,就有众多业界人士呼吁用CMP(单芯片...直到AMD抢先手推出64位处理器后,英特尔才想起利用“多核

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 23,392
精华内容 9,356
关键字:

多核处理器是什么计算机